Application Number: 16/0055 - 7 Tekels Way, Camberley GU15 1HX

Minutes:

This application was for erection of a single storey detached building with flat roof in rear garden to be used as an annexe to main dwelling. (Amended plans rec'd 03/03/16).

 

This application would normally be determined under the Council’s Scheme of Delegation, however, at the request of a local ward councillor it has been called in for determination by the Planning Applications Committee.

 

Members were advised of the following update:

 

It has been brought to officers’ attention that the GIS map on page 59 of the committee papers incorrectly defines the application site and does not extend to its full depth.

 

A proposed amendment to condition 4 is detailed below:

 

4.       The development hereby approved shall be occupied only as residential accommodation ancillary to the use of the dwelling currently known as 7 Tekels Way and shall not be used as an independent residential unit or business premises (other than as a home office for the sole use of the occupiers of 7 Tekels Way).

 

Reason: To ensure that the dwelling remains in single family occupation and does not give rise to harmful impacts upon the Thames Basin Heaths Special Protection Area, infrastructure, character, amenity or parking provision in accordance with Policies DM9, CP11, CP12 and CP14 of the Surrey Heath Core Strategy and Development Management Policies Document 2012 and the National Planning Policy Framework.

 

Members expressed concern that the permissions proposed would not sufficiently prevent subletting or subdivision in the future. To further strengthen the considions recommended by the officers, it was proposed that the following additional conditions be incorporated:

 

(i)         No subletting or subdivision, with usage limited to those ancillary purposes for 7 Tekels Way only; and

 

(ii)        Further Class E permitted development rights be removed.

 

Resolved that application 16/0055 be approved subject to the conditions as set out in the report of the Executive Head – Regulatory, with the inclusion of the following additional conditions:

 

(i)        No subletting or subdivision, with usage limited to those ancillary purposes for 7 Tekels Way only; and

 

(ii)       Further Class E permitted development rights be removed.
